The statue of Hercules and Cacus, one of the sons of Vulcan, is located at the entrance of the palace, at the other side of David. Since the 14th century the Piazza della Signoria has been the historical center of Florence's political activity and is rich with architecture and sculptures. The sculpture of Hercules and Cacus was originally commissioned to Michelangelo by the Republican Government of Florence as a companion piece for David by Michelangelo, to be positioned at the entrance of the Palazzo della Signoria. Evil, Bad ( kakos) KAKOS (Cacus) was a monstrous, fire-breathing giant who dwelt in a cave on the Aventine Hill in Latium--later the site of Rome. Bandinelli produced a falsified genealogy connecting him with the noble Bandinelli of Siena in preparation for his induction into the chivalric Order of St James by Charles V, in Rome, 1530. It is recorded that the statue underwent a restoration in 1845 at the hands of Lorenzo Bartolini, so it is entirely possible that the pedestal we now know differs from the original.
